FAQ
What size coffee table is best for my living room?
What size coffee table is best for my living room?
Ideal coffee table size formula: Coffee Table Length = 2/3 × Sofa Length For spacing, keep the coffee table 12"–18" away from the sofa for comfortable legroom and accessibility.
What’s the difference between a coffee table and an end table?
What’s the difference between a coffee table and an end table?
Coffee tables are larger, placed in the center of the seating area for convenience. End tables (also called side tables) are smaller, placed beside sofas or chairs to hold drinks, lamps, or remote controls.
Should a coffee table match the sofa or TV stand?
Should a coffee table match the sofa or TV stand?
Your coffee table doesn’t have to match perfectly but should complement your sofa or TV stand. Mixing materials (e.g., a wooden table with a leather sofa) can create contrast, but aim for a harmonious color scheme and style that ties everything together.
What height should a coffee table be compared to the sofa?
What height should a coffee table be compared to the sofa?
Ideally, the coffee table’s height should be around 1–2 inches lower than the seat height of the sofa. This ensures a comfortable reach and visual balance.
Are round or rectangular coffee tables better?
Are round or rectangular coffee tables better?
Round tables are great for small spaces and homes with kids, as they eliminate sharp corners. Rectangular tables are more traditional and work well in larger rooms, offering more surface area and a structured look.
What materials are most durable for coffee tables?
What materials are most durable for coffee tables?
Wood: Sturdy and timeless, but can be scratched. Glass: Elegant but may require more maintenance and care. Metal: Highly durable and resistant to heat and scratches. Marble: Luxurious but can be prone to staining if not sealed properly.
How far should the coffee table be from the sofa?
How far should the coffee table be from the sofa?
A gap of 12"–18" between the coffee table and sofa is optimal. This provides enough space for movement while keeping the table within easy reach.
Are coffee tables safe for homes with children/pets?
Are coffee tables safe for homes with children/pets?
Look for rounded corners and sturdy bases to prevent tipping. Choose tip-resistant designs for added safety, and avoid heavy glass or sharp-edged tables that could pose risks to young children or pets.

Which coffee table fits your space?
Options | Suitable Room | Key Points | Recommended Features |
---|---|---|---|
Small spaces | Small apartments, studios | Compact size, easy to move | Round or compact design, lightweight, and flexible |
Large space | Spacious living room | Visual center sense | Large rectangle, stable, and majestic |
Storage seekers | Families with many small household items | Multifunctional storage | Drawers, shelves, hidden spaces |
Multifunctional needs | Small apartment, limited space room | Balancing work and dining | Lift up table, adjustable table |
Style matching | Various decoration styles in rooms | Beauty and harmony | Rustic wood or modern glass and metal texture |
Coffee table buying tips
- Measure your space to ensure the table fits, leaving 16–18 inches between the sofa and the table.
- Choose a table height close to your sofa cushions (around 16–18 inches) for a balanced and comfortable look.
- Match the table size to your seating area: round or square for small spaces, rectangular for large rooms.
- Consider storage options like drawers or hidden compartments; lift-top tables offer extra versatility.
- Pick a style that complements your room, from rustic wood to modern glass or metal.
